The Benefits of Fishing for Kids

Promotes Patience and Focus

One of the most significant lessons children learn from fishing is patience. Waiting patiently for a fish to bite teaches kids to stay calm and focused, skills that are valuable in many areas of life. The quiet anticipation involved in fishing helps children develop concentration and self-control, fostering a sense of achievement when they finally catch a fish.

Encourages Creativity and Imagination

Fishing also sparks creativity. Kids often imagine themselves as explorers, adventurers, or even characters from their favorite stories. Setting up the fishing gear, choosing the perfect bait, and strategizing where to fish all stimulate imaginative thinking. These experiences can inspire children to create stories, drawings, or even pretend play scenarios based on their fishing adventures.

Teaches Respect for Nature

Spending time outdoors allows children to develop a deeper appreciation for the environment. Fishing encourages respect for aquatic ecosystems and wildlife, fostering a sense of stewardship. Kids learn about different fish species, water conservation, and the importance of preserving natural habitats, instilling environmental consciousness from a young age.

How Fishing Enhances Family Bonding and Social Skills

Fishing is often a shared activity that strengthens family bonds. Whether it’s a parent teaching a child how to cast or siblings sharing stories by the water, these moments create lasting memories. Additionally, fishing can be a social activity, promoting teamwork and communication skills as children learn to work together, share equipment, and celebrate each other’s successes.
